
Router blunder leaves designers fuming as businesses spend more than a day offline...
Published: 30 May 2001 12:00 GMT
A major BT router breakdown in Reading has left businesses with inaccessible websites and no email access since Tuesday morning.
Subscribers to the ISP Fasthosts.co.uk, widely used by web designers who rely on the BT-underpinned service for their web-hosting business, are furious they haven't been able to gain access to online resources since 05:00GMT yesterday.
Alan Coxon, MD of web design firm Coxon's, said: "Having tried to upgrade the service, BT has in fact made a total mess. IP addresses that run through Fasthosts are knackered, leaving potentially thousands of websites offline."
The claim was backed up by Ian Harrison, technical director at design firm Hartech Deign, which had a flood of inquiries from 20 to 30 customers demanding to know where their websites had gone.
He added: "We have an excellent service from Fasthosts, but as usual BT has let down ISPs, like they've always done."
He pointed to one of the firm's customers JoeBrowns.co.uk - a clothing retailer which had spent a lot of money on a major ad campaign recently was also offline, leaving them extremely unhappy.
A spokesman for BT said: "We tested the router yesterday morning and found it was fine. But, since then it hasn't been working. We are still hard at work on it, but there is a bit of a problem that we haven't yet found the cause of."
